Overview
The Hengyi HY(WE)600060 is a microcomputer-controlled electro-hydraulic servo universal testing machine engineered for high-reliability mechanical property evaluation of metallic and non-metallic structural materials. It operates on the principle of closed-loop hydraulic actuation with real-time force, displacement, and strain feedback—enabling precise execution of tensile, compression, bending, and shear tests per internationally recognized standards including ASTM E8/E9/E21, ISO 6892-1, ISO 7500-1, and GB/T 228.1–2021. The machine features a bottom-mounted hydraulic cylinder design with adjustable test space, ensuring optimal alignment and minimal parasitic moments during high-load testing. Its robust dual-column frame architecture supports stable load application up to 600 kN while maintaining structural rigidity under dynamic cycling conditions.
Key Features
- Electro-hydraulic servo system with high-bandwidth proportional servo valve for responsive and repeatable load control
- Imported high-precision load cell (±1% accuracy) and linear variable differential transformer (LVDT)-based displacement sensor (±0.5% FS) for traceable metrology
- Full digital closed-loop control architecture supporting constant stress, constant strain, and constant crosshead speed modes
- Adjustable test space: 600 mm for tension and 600 mm for compression, with piston stroke of 150 mm for extended deformation capability
- Multi-function gripping system: standard wedge-action clamps for round specimens (Φ13–40 mm), flat specimens (0–30 mm), bending fixtures (span adjustable from 100–540 mm), and dedicated shear fixtures (Φ10 mm)
- Integrated safety interlocks including overload protection, emergency stop circuitry, and software-based upper/lower limit enforcement
- Modular hardware platform compatible with future calibration upgrades and third-party transducer integration
Sample Compatibility & Compliance
The HY(WE)600060 accommodates standardized test specimens conforming to ISO 6892-1 (tensile testing of metallic materials), ISO 15630-1 (steel reinforcement), ASTM A370 (mechanical testing of steel products), and GB/T 232 (bend testing). It supports both metallic (structural steel, aluminum alloys, titanium, fasteners) and non-metallic (concrete cylinders, cementitious composites, polymer-reinforced panels) specimen geometries. All measurement subsystems comply with ISO/IEC 17025 requirements for calibration traceability. The system meets essential performance criteria outlined in JJG 139–2014 (Chinese national verification regulation for universal testing machines) and supports audit-ready documentation for GLP and GMP environments.
Software & Data Management
The included Hengyi proprietary test control and analysis software provides full compliance with 21 CFR Part 11 requirements—including electronic signatures, user role management, audit trail logging, and data integrity safeguards. Real-time plotting displays force–displacement, stress–strain, and time-based parameter curves. Test sequences are programmable via graphical workflow editor; raw data export supports CSV, XML, and PDF formats. Automated report generation includes customizable templates aligned with ISO 5893 and ASTM E4 formats. Software supports remote diagnostics, firmware updates, and seamless integration with LIMS platforms via OPC UA or TCP/IP protocols.

FAQ
What standards does this machine support for tensile testing?
It fully complies with GB/T 228.1–2021, ASTM E8/E21, ISO 6892-1, and EN ISO 6892-1 for metallic material tensile testing.
Can the system perform cyclic loading or low-cycle fatigue tests?
Yes—the electro-hydraulic servo architecture supports programmed waveforms (sine, triangle, trapezoidal) with frequency ranges up to 5 Hz and full closed-loop control of force or displacement amplitude.
Is the software validated for regulated environments such as pharmaceutical or aerospace QA labs?
Yes—the software includes 21 CFR Part 11-compliant features: audit trails, electronic signatures, role-based access control, and immutable data archiving.
What maintenance intervals are recommended for hydraulic system components?
Oil filtration and replacement every 1,500 operating hours; servo valve recalibration every 2 years or after 50,000 cycles, per ISO 16122 guidelines.
Does the machine support third-party extensometers or environmental chambers?
Yes—it offers analog and digital I/O interfaces (±10 V, RS-485, Ethernet) for synchronization with clip-on extensometers, furnace systems, or cryogenic chambers.
